A SCHOOL near Wantage has been given a cash boost to help restock its library.

Regional housebuilder Persimmon Homes donated £1,000 to Grove CE Primary School, through its Community Champions scheme.

Jo Nation, from the school's Parent Teacher Association, said: “Grove Primary is a small school and unfortunately we struggle for funds, so fundraising and donations like this are so important to us. It’s great to see a large company supporting local causes.

“It’s important to keep resources and reading material up-to-date, we want to provide an engaging environment for students to enjoy reading and learn.”

Pauline Fletcher, sales director from Persimmon Homes Wessex, added: “We strongly believe in supporting the communities where we build, and we are delighted to be able to help a local primary school in this way.

“We hope lots of pupils will benefit from these resources for years to come.”
